Google Groups is not usenet. Google Groups is a combination of

1) A searchable archive of most of the articles posted into most
usenet newsgroups in the last 20 years or so, purchased by Google
from 'DejaNews' who started it.

2) A badly designed web forum interface to allow reading and posting
in those newsgroups.

3) Google's own proprietary web forums, which are not part of usenet.
For reasons of their own, Google do not make the distinction
between their own web forums and the real newsgroups very clear.

1) is a useful service. 2) and 3) are means of getting people to look at
and occasionally click on the advertisements that Google display, and
which earn them their money.

May I make one more suggestion, Curse?

In this group (as in the parent rec.photo.digital), the preference is for
the text you post to follow the message to which it refers, and to cut as
much as possible while leaving enough original text to establish the
context of your reply. This is often referred to as "bottom posting", and
can become an emotional issue with some people. If you can follow this
convention, many people will approve of your style.
